Essential Estate Planning Documents for 2025
Establishing a solid estate planning strategy lays the groundwork for your financial future. By prioritizing key actions, you are taking significant steps to safeguard your assets and provide for your loved ones. In 2025, certain documents serve as the cornerstone of any estate plan, offering protection and clarity for you and your beneficiaries.
Key documents to include in your estate plan may consist of:
- Financial Power Of Attorney – Designate a trustworthy individual to manage your financial affairs.
- Last Will And Testament – Clearly outline your final wishes to avoid state intervention.
- Trusts – Consider utilizing trusts to better suit your specific circumstances.
- Living Will – Detail your healthcare preferences and medical treatment directives.
Having these documents in place simplifies decision-making and eases the burden on your loved ones during challenging times. A comprehensive approach to estate planning is essential for long-term security.
Significance of Trusts and Wills in Estate Planning
Understanding the importance of trusts and wills is crucial in maintaining an organized estate. While each serves distinct purposes, the ultimate goal is to ensure the seamless management of your assets.
Reasons to prioritize trusts and wills include:
- Asset Protection – Safeguard your assets for future generations.
- Decision-Making Authority – Entrust key decisions to reliable individuals.
- Preventing Inheritance Issues – Specify beneficiaries to avoid potential conflicts.
Despite initial costs, the long-term benefits of establishing trusts and wills far outweigh the expenses. Careful planning allows you to make informed decisions that benefit you and your heirs in the years to come.

Strategies for Allocating Assets to Beneficiaries
Determining how to distribute assets among multiple beneficiaries can be challenging. Tailoring your estate plan to meet the individual needs of each beneficiary ensures a fair and equitable distribution of assets.
Consider the following tips:
- Assess the value of each asset to align with beneficiaries’ specific requirements.
- Clearly articulate reasons for asset distribution to avoid confusion or disputes.
- Establish backup plans to address unforeseen circumstances and changes in life situations.
Implementing these strategies ensures a practical and effective estate plan that meets the needs of your beneficiaries.
